In order to erase the traces of forest fires occurring throughout Turkey and to regenerate forest areas with special afforestation techniques, feverish work continues in the forest nurseries of the General Directorate of Forestry (OGM). The saplings, which are grown like a baby by paying attention to the heat, humidity and fertilizer balance in the nurseries, are planted all over the country both in areas damaged by forest fires and in forested areas. A THOUSAND DIFFERENT SPECIES ARE GROWED Saplings, which are indispensable for afforestation, are coniferous such as pine, cedar, spruce, juniper, cypress; leafy such as oak, beech, maple, linden, chestnut, ash, sycamore; It is grown in income-generating species such as almonds, walnuts, olives, hawthorn, jujube, carob, oleaster, rosehip.
